Germiston City Cricket Club excited for new chapter

Germiston City Cricket Club (GCCC), in partnership with Thusong Youth Network aims to spark a love of cricket in the city’s youth.

Germiston City Cricket Club (GCCC), in partnership with Thusong Youth Network (NPO), will launch an exciting new chapter this year.

“The Germiston City Cricket Club-Junior Cricket Development Agency (GCCC-JCDA), the brainchild of Thusong Youth Network, will be launched this year,” said David Ungerer, chairperson of GCCC.

“The main aim of the development agency is to generate interest and passion for cricket in children, in the hope that they will be able to participate in competitive environments later in life.

“GCCC-JCDA is currently working towards affiliation with Easterns Cricket.”

On top of instilling a love of cricket the programme offers children a safe environment to spend their time, throughout the year.

“GCCC-JCDA is driven by a passion for child empowerment and sports development,” said Kudakwashe Dzapasi, founder and CEO of Thusong Youth Network.

“Our mission is to use sport as a developmental tool to fight child abuse and substance abuse through the provision of alternative opportunities to the underprivileged and marginalised children within our communities.

“In addition, relationships have been fostered with a number of schools and orphanages, to work collaboratively towards implementing the programme.

“Above all, as GCCC-JCDA, we value the local communities we work in, as our quest is to bring about meaningful social impact to our children.”

Registration for the programme opened on May 20 and is open to boys and girls, aged between seven and 14 years old, who are residents of Germiston and surrounding areas.

Practices will start on June 1 at Germiston City Sports Grounds.
